Are Metro Detroit Real Estate Markets Starting to Improve?

Here is a clip that was recently on wxyz (channel 7) in Detroit.

It talks about how some real estate markets in Michigan, specifically Oakland County and Macomb County, are staring to show improvements.

The video states that the number of homes sold in Macomb County have increased by 6.4% and the number home sold in Oakland County has increase by 25%.

They also talk about the home buyer tax credit, although they state that you have to close by April 30th, you only need to be in contract by that date.
